WMCHealth’s Liver Transplant Program is one of the oldest and most established transplant centers in the country. Since the program began, our teams have performed over 1,300 adult and pediatric liver transplants. Our physicians and surgeons handle the most complex cases requiring expertise and precision. In addition to deceased donor transplants, we also offer living donor transplant and multiorgan transplant. In fact, our center ranks among the top 25% of U.S. transplant centers for multiorgan transplant volume since 1996.
Inpatients and outpatients are managed both pre-transplant for the complications of liver failure, and post-transplantation to maintain graft function. The multi-disciplinary care of these complex patients integrates several medical specialties, as well as social workers, nutritionists, and coordinators.

About WMCHealth Network
The Westchester Medical Center Health Network (WMCHealth) is a 1,700-bed healthcare system headquartered in Valhalla, New York, with nine hospitals on seven campuses spanning 6,200 square miles of the Hudson Valley and approximately $3 billion in annual revenue. WMCHealth employs more than 12,000 people and has nearly 3,000 attending physicians who care for more than 381,000 patients annually. WMCHealth sponsors 31 GME programs, with over 300 residents and fellows. Today WMCHealth is the pre-eminent provider of integrated healthcare in the Hudson Valley.
The network includes Level I adult and pediatric trauma centers in Valhalla, and affiliated Level II trauma centers; the region’s only advanced care children’s hospital, the academic medical center with vigorous teaching and research programs; several community hospitals; dozens of specialized institutes and centers, including Comprehensive and Primary Stroke Centers; skilled nursing and assisted-living facilities; homecare services; and one of the largest mental health systems in New York State.
